Saudi Arabia Pushes Two-State Solution at Global Alliance Meeting in Dublin

Saudi Arabia has reaffirmed support for the two-state solution path at the eighth meeting of the Global Alliance for the Implementation of the Two-State Solution.

During the meeting, held in Ireland’s capital Dublin, the Kingdom stressed that achieving an independent Palestinian State remains the only viable path to lasting peace in the region.

Crucial Platform

Minister Plenipotentiary at the Saudi Foreign Ministry, Dr. Manal Radwan, represented Saudi Arabia in the eighth meeting of the Global Alliance for the Implementation of the Two-State Solution.

Held under the auspices of the Irish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ade, the meeting saw wide participation from member states and international partners, according to the Saudi Press Agency (SPA).

During her speech, Dr. Radwan emphasized the crucial role of the Global Alliance as a unique international platform for harmonizing peace efforts, ensuring their consistency and effectiveness in driving a political solution.

Furthermore, she praised the US pivotal role and efforts led by President Donald Trump, noting that coordination with the US to implement the comprehensive peace plan provides a real opportunity to end the conflict, paving the way for regional integration and long-term stability.

Gaza Peace Plan

The UN Security Council (UNSC) adopted resolution 2803 in November 2025, endorsing Trump’s 20-point peace plan for Gaza. This resolution endorses the creation of the Board of Peace as proposed in the plan, granting the Board and UN member states the mandate to deploy a temporary International Stabilization Force (ISF) in Gaza.

During her speech, Dr. Radwan highlighted the importance of implementing the UNSC Resolution 2803 as the legal and political framework for this phase, specifically regarding the mandate of the Board of Peace, ensuring the withdrawal of Israeli forces, ending the occupation, and creating the necessary conditions for political progress.

In this context, she referred to the Irish peace-building model as proof that complex conflicts are solvable through comprehensive processes, clear political horizons, and the replacement of violence with dialogue and trust.

Intensified Diplomatic Efforts

The Saudi representative renewed warnings over the gravity of Israeli forces’ persistent violations of the ceasefire agreement, stressing the significance of the New York Declaration, the comprehensive peace plan, and the UNSC Resolution 2803, which constitute an integrated framework with consistent and mutually reinforcing objectives.

Moreover, she noted that the current phase needs intensified diplomatic efforts, dialogue and joint action to ensure the path does not deviate from its core objectives of ending the conflict and establishing peace.

In light of this, she underscored the need to support the Palestinian National Authority, build its institutional capacities, and ensure the institutional and geographic connectivity between Gaza and the West Bank, preserving the territorial integrity of Palestine.

Saudi Commitment to Peace

Saudi Arabia has been a steadfast champion of peace, advocating Palestinian rights to self-determination and an independent state.

To this end, the Kingdom launched the Global Alliance for the Implementation of the Two-State Solution, in partnership with Norway and the European Union (EU) in September 2024.

As the leader of this alliance, Saudi Arabia has leveraged its diplomatic weight to mobilize international support for the establishment of an independent Palestinian State.

These efforts led to a wave of recognitions from major Western powers, as well as the adoption of the New York Declaration, which charts an irreversible path to Palestinian Statehood.

Within this context, Dr. Radwan underscored Saudi Arabia’s commitment to continuing collaboration with regional and international partners to achieve a just and lasting peace that fulfills the aspirations of the Palestinian people for self-determination and the establishment of an independent state, and ensures security and stability for the peoples of the region.
